How To Choose The Best Antiperspirant Deodorant Spray
The difference between a spray that works and one that wastes your money comes down to three things: the active antiperspirant ingredient, the spray delivery system (dry vs. wet), and the stain-protection technology. A spray deodorant alone masks odor with fragrance but does nothing for wetness. An antiperspirant spray uses aluminum-based salts to physically block sweat ducts. If you actually sweat, skip anything labeled just “deodorant spray” and look for “antiperspirant” on the can.
Active Ingredient Strength
The primary active in almost every antiperspirant spray is Aluminum Zirconium Tetrachlorohydrex Gly—a mouthful that matters. A 15–20% concentration is standard for all-day effectiveness. Lower concentrations won’t stop heavy sweating, while formulas above that range can irritate sensitive skin. Check the Drug Facts panel on the back of the can; if the aluminum percentage isn’t listed, the brand is hiding a weak formulation.
Dry Spray vs. Wet Spray Application
Dry sprays (like the Degree and Dove options in this guide) use a fine aerosol that evaporates almost instantly, leaving zero residue. You can pull on a black undershirt 10 seconds after spraying. Wet sprays feel cool and damp on application and take one to two minutes to fully dry. Dry sprays are the modern standard for convenience, especially if you’re rushing out the door.
Stain Protection Technology
White marks on dark shirts and yellow armpit stains on white fabric are the two most common antiperspirant complaints. Premium sprays now include anti-white-mark and anti-yellow-stain formulas—usually via a clear-dry polymer that prevents the aluminum salts from bonding to fabric fibers. If you wear a lot of black or white clothing, prioritize a “Black + White” or “Invisible” label.
